Output be95f74bb50423a173bdd66ba43500ef0d339a21ee00aee6beca570319726289:4

value
1164348
script pubkey
OP_0 OP_PUSHBYTES_20 e5f51506c78cda89e5eaa33efb1f11ef1893fbbf
address
bc1quh632pk83ndgne025vl0k8c3auvf87almxq67f
transaction
be95f74bb50423a173bdd66ba43500ef0d339a21ee00aee6beca570319726289
confirmations
185569
spent
true